Deadly Truths exposes the crimes, cover-ups, and institutional failures buried in American history. From forgotten murders and cold cases to Hollywood myths, mob violence, and frontier bloodshed—this is true crime without glamor. Archival facts. Hard questions. No fiction. Because the past isn’t dead—it’s just been rewritten.

What is Deadly Truths about and what kind of topics does it cover?

This show focuses on historical crimes, scandals, and systemic failures across American history, blending deep archival detail with storytelling to reveal how violence, corruption, and media narratives shaped the past. Episodes cover gangster eras, mob dynamics, infamous murders, frontier justice, and Hollywood myths, often linking crime to immigration, class, gender, and power. The format tends to balance narrative breath with analytical context, spotlighting how societal structures enabled or obscured wrongdoing. Overall, it's a rigorous true-crime/history hybrid that rewards listeners who enjoy well-researched storytelling about how the past was written—and sometimes rewritten.
